package java.time.zone; |
|
import java.io.DataInput; |
|
import java.io.DataOutput; |
|
import java.io.Externalizable; |
|
import java.io.IOException; |
|
import java.io.InvalidClassException; |
|
import java.io.ObjectInput; |
|
import java.io.ObjectOutput; |
|
import java.io.StreamCorruptedException; |
|
import java.time.ZoneOffset; |
|
/** |
|
* The shared serialization delegate for this package. |
|
* |
|
* @implNote |
|
* This class is mutable and should be created once per serialization. |
|
* |
|
* @serial include |
|
* @since 1.8 |
|
*/ |
|
final class Ser implements Externalizable { |
|
/** |
|
* Serialization version. |
|
*/ |
|
private static final long serialVersionUID = -8885321777449118786L; |
|
/** Type for ZoneRules. */ |
|
static final byte ZRULES = 1; |
|
/** Type for ZoneOffsetTransition. */ |
|
static final byte ZOT = 2; |
|
/** Type for ZoneOffsetTransition. */ |
|
static final byte ZOTRULE = 3; |
|
/** The type being serialized. */ |
|
private byte type; |
|
/** The object being serialized. */ |
|
private Object object; |
|
/** |
|
* Constructor for deserialization. |
|
*/ |
|
public Ser() { |
|
} |
|
/** |
|
* Creates an instance for serialization. |
|
* |
|
* @param type the type |
|
* @param object the object |
|
*/ |
|
Ser(byte type, Object object) { |
|
this.type = type; |
|
this.object = object; |
|
} |
|
//----------------------------------------------------------------------- |
|
/** |
|
* Implements the {@code Externalizable} interface to write the object. |
|
* @serialData |
|
* Each serializable class is mapped to a type that is the first byte |
|
* in the stream. Refer to each class {@code writeReplace} |
|
* serialized form for the value of the type and sequence of values for the type. |
|
* |
|
* <ul> |
|
* <li><a href="../../../serialized-form.html#java.time.zone.ZoneRules">ZoneRules.writeReplace</a> |
|
* <li><a href="../../../serialized-form.html#java.time.zone.ZoneOffsetTransition">ZoneOffsetTransition.writeReplace</a> |
|
* <li><a href="../../../serialized-form.html#java.time.zone.ZoneOffsetTransitionRule">ZoneOffsetTransitionRule.writeReplace</a> |
|
* </ul> |
|
* |
|
* @param out the data stream to write to, not null |
|
*/ |
|
@Override |
|
public void writeExternal(ObjectOutput out) throws IOException { |
|
writeInternal(type, object, out); |
|
} |
|
static void write(Object object, DataOutput out) throws IOException { |
|
writeInternal(ZRULES, object, out); |
|
} |
|
private static void writeInternal(byte type, Object object, DataOutput out) throws IOException { |
|
out.writeByte(type); |
|
switch (type) { |
|
case ZRULES: |
|
((ZoneRules) object).writeExternal(out); |
|
break; |
|
case ZOT: |
|
((ZoneOffsetTransition) object).writeExternal(out); |
|
break; |
|
case ZOTRULE: |
|
((ZoneOffsetTransitionRule) object).writeExternal(out); |
|
break; |
|
default: |
|
throw new InvalidClassException("Unknown serialized type"); |
|
} |
|
} |
|
//----------------------------------------------------------------------- |
|
/** |
|
* Implements the {@code Externalizable} interface to read the object. |
|
* @serialData |
|
* The streamed type and parameters defined by the type's {@code writeReplace} |
|
* method are read and passed to the corresponding static factory for the type |
|
* to create a new instance. That instance is returned as the de-serialized |
|
* {@code Ser} object. |
|
* |
|
* <ul> |
|
* <li><a href="../../../serialized-form.html#java.time.zone.ZoneRules">ZoneRules</a> |
|
* - {@code ZoneRules.of(standardTransitions, standardOffsets, savingsInstantTransitions, wallOffsets, lastRules);} |
|
* <li><a href="../../../serialized-form.html#java.time.zone.ZoneOffsetTransition">ZoneOffsetTransition</a> |
|
* - {@code ZoneOffsetTransition of(LocalDateTime.ofEpochSecond(epochSecond), offsetBefore, offsetAfter);} |
|
* <li><a href="../../../serialized-form.html#java.time.zone.ZoneOffsetTransitionRule">ZoneOffsetTransitionRule</a> |
|
* - {@code ZoneOffsetTransitionRule.of(month, dom, dow, time, timeEndOfDay, timeDefinition, standardOffset, offsetBefore, offsetAfter);} |
|
* </ul> |
|
* @param in the data to read, not null |
|
*/ |
|
@Override |
|
public void readExternal(ObjectInput in) throws IOException, ClassNotFoundException { |
|
type = in.readByte(); |
|
object = readInternal(type, in); |
|
} |
|
static Object read(DataInput in) throws IOException, ClassNotFoundException { |
|
byte type = in.readByte(); |
|
return readInternal(type, in); |
|
} |
|
private static Object readInternal(byte type, DataInput in) throws IOException, ClassNotFoundException { |
|
switch (type) { |
|
case ZRULES: |
|
return ZoneRules.readExternal(in); |
|
case ZOT: |
|
return ZoneOffsetTransition.readExternal(in); |
|
case ZOTRULE: |
|
return ZoneOffsetTransitionRule.readExternal(in); |
|
default: |
|
throw new StreamCorruptedException("Unknown serialized type"); |
|
} |
|
} |
|
/** |
|
* Returns the object that will replace this one. |
|
* |
|
* @return the read object, should never be null |
|
*/ |
|
private Object readResolve() { |
|
return object; |
|
} |
|
//----------------------------------------------------------------------- |
|
/** |
|
* Writes the state to the stream. |
|
* |
|
* @param offset the offset, not null |
|
* @param out the output stream, not null |
|
* @throws IOException if an error occurs |
|
*/ |
|
static void writeOffset(ZoneOffset offset, DataOutput out) throws IOException { |
|
final int offsetSecs = offset.getTotalSeconds(); |
|
int offsetByte = offsetSecs % 900 == 0 ? offsetSecs / 900 : 127; // compress to -72 to +72 |
|
out.writeByte(offsetByte); |
|
if (offsetByte == 127) { |
|
out.writeInt(offsetSecs); |
|
} |
|
} |
|
/** |
|
* Reads the state from the stream. |
|
* |
|
* @param in the input stream, not null |
|
* @return the created object, not null |
|
* @throws IOException if an error occurs |
|
*/ |
|
static ZoneOffset readOffset(DataInput in) throws IOException { |
|
int offsetByte = in.readByte(); |
|
return (offsetByte == 127 ? ZoneOffset.ofTotalSeconds(in.readInt()) : ZoneOffset.ofTotalSeconds(offsetByte * 900)); |
|
} |
|
//----------------------------------------------------------------------- |
|
/** |
|
* Writes the state to the stream. |
|
* |
|
* @param epochSec the epoch seconds, not null |
|
* @param out the output stream, not null |
|
* @throws IOException if an error occurs |
|
*/ |
|
static void writeEpochSec(long epochSec, DataOutput out) throws IOException { |
|
if (epochSec >= -4575744000L && epochSec < 10413792000L && epochSec % 900 == 0) { // quarter hours between 1825 and 2300 |
|
int store = (int) ((epochSec + 4575744000L) / 900); |
|
out.writeByte((store >>> 16) & 255); |
|
out.writeByte((store >>> 8) & 255); |
|
out.writeByte(store & 255); |
|
} else { |
|
out.writeByte(255); |
|
out.writeLong(epochSec); |
|
} |
|
} |
|
/** |
|
* Reads the state from the stream. |
|
* |
|
* @param in the input stream, not null |
|
* @return the epoch seconds, not null |
|
* @throws IOException if an error occurs |
|
*/ |
|
static long readEpochSec(DataInput in) throws IOException { |
|
int hiByte = in.readByte() & 255; |
|
if (hiByte == 255) { |
|
return in.readLong(); |
|
} else { |
|
int midByte = in.readByte() & 255; |
|
int loByte = in.readByte() & 255; |
|
long tot = ((hiByte << 16) + (midByte << 8) + loByte); |
|
return (tot * 900) - 4575744000L; |
|
} |
|
} |
|
} |
